Provost’s monthly “Ask Me Anything” session set for Turtle Island Walk

Every month during term time, provost Douglas Kneale sets up somewhere on campus to hear from students, faculty, and staff. On Wednesday, September 27, he’ll be meeting with them outdoors, on Turtle Island Walk, at the conversation pods in front of Chrysler Hall Tower from 11:30 a.m. to 1 p.m. And he’s bringing cookies.

“Ask Me Anything sessions are just that: a chance for people on campus to talk to me, and for me to hear what people are thinking,” says Dr. Kneale. “September is always a great event — the energy and promise of the new year is still buzzing, and everyone has great ideas and questions to share. The provost is listening!”

Bring your lunch, if you like. Kneale will supply the dessert.

In case of rain, Ask Me Anything will take place in the lobby of the Toldo Health Education Centre.
